Output e4aaeb71345ee08e3476b36473552ec701d87e38a174e7aa4220a2791edda937:2

value
8506879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db53897e63e9a57419381ea112dd663a2ed30a8 OP_EQUAL
address
38mu3mv8LscUnNbCpXvuKCppiJYKDhDWAe
transaction
e4aaeb71345ee08e3476b36473552ec701d87e38a174e7aa4220a2791edda937
spent
true